So, What’s the Big Deal with Steam Anyway?
Think about boiling water. Simple, right? But harness that power correctly, and it becomes a cleaning superhero. Steam cleaning – or hot water extraction, as we pros call it – uses seriously hot water (we’re talking 212°F or even higher!) turned into vapor. This isn’t your grandma’s kettle steam; it’s pressurized and powerful. Here’s the basic play-by-play:
- Heat It Up: Our truck-mounted or portable units heat water to extreme temperatures. FYI, hotter water = better cleaning and sanitizing.
- Pressure Play: That hot water is forced out under high pressure through a special wand and into your carpet or rug fibers. This pressure blast loosens dirt, grime, oils, and even nasties like bacteria and dust mites that are clinging on for dear life.
- The Suck Back (The Real MVP): This is the step cheap rentals often miss the mark on. Immediately after injecting the hot water and cleaning solution (we use eco-friendly ones, IMO the only way to go!), a powerful vacuum sucks it all back up. This pulls out the dissolved dirt, allergens, and moisture. Leaving your carpets cleaner and drier than other methods.
Why We’re Team Steam All the Way
Look, we’ve seen every cleaning method under the sun in our years serving Nassau County. Shampoos leave sticky residue. Dry powders? Often just a surface fix. Steam cleaning? It’s our gold standard for good reason:
- Deep Down Clean: That pressurized hot water penetrates deep into the carpet backing and pad, yanking out dirt other methods just can’t reach. Ever had a carpet look clean but feel gritty? Yeah, steam fixes that.
- Allergen Annihilation: Dust mites, pet dander, pollen – steam’s high heat kills them dead. If allergies are kicking your butt in Wantagh or Bellmore, this is a game-changer.
- Stain Slaying: Especially tough on organic stains like dog urine smell, coffee, wine, and food spills. The heat breaks down the proteins and sugars that cause odors and discoloration.
- No Nasty Residue: Since we’re sucking almost all the moisture and solution back out, there’s no sticky film left behind to attract dirt again next week. Your carpet stays cleaner longer. Win!
- Sanitization Station: That high heat naturally disinfects without needing harsh chemicals. Great for homes with kids, pets, or anyone who just prefers a healthier home.

Got water damage? While steam cleaning uses water, it’s not the first step for water damage restoration. Extraction and drying come first to prevent mold. Then, once everything is dry and sanitized, steam cleaning can be part of the final refresh. We handle that whole process too!

Caring for the Delicate Ones: Your Fine Rugs
We get nervous when folks try DIY on heirlooms. Silk rugs and viscose rugs are incredibly absorbent and sensitive to heat and moisture. Too hot? The fibers melt or distort. Too wet? Colors bleed or the foundation weakens. Wool rugs are more resilient but can still felt if agitated incorrectly. Persian rugs and cotton rugs have their own quirks. This isn’t a gamble. Our rug cleaning service involves meticulous hand-inspection, customized low-moisture steam or specialized cleaning methods, and controlled drying. Steam Cleaning vs. The World: A Quick Comparison
| Feature | Steam Cleaning (Hot Water Extraction) | Dry Cleaning (Compound/Chemical) | Shampooing (Foam)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cleaning Depth | Deepest (into backing/pad) | Surface to Mid-Level | Surface |
| Moisture Left | Low (with professional equipment) | Very Low | High (Slow Drying) |
| Residue Left | Minimal (Proper Extraction Key) | Low to Moderate | High (Attracts Dirt) |
| Allergen Removal | Best (Heat Kills Mites/Bacteria) | Fair | Poor |
| Stain Removal | Excellent (Especially Organic) | Good (Surface Stains) | Fair |
| Best For | Deep dirt, allergens, pet odors, overall refresh | Quick turnaround, delicate fabrics | Quick, low-cost surface clean (but short-lived) |
| DIY Friendly? | Possible (rental), but results vary wildly | Moderate | Easy |
Your Burning Steam Cleaning Questions, Answered
-
“Will steam cleaning ruin my carpets or make them shrink?”
- Absolutely not, when done professionally with the correct equipment and techniques. We control the temperature, pressure, and moisture extraction meticulously. Improper DIY attempts can cause issues, which is why we see so many “help!” calls. We know the limits of your specific carpet.
-
“How long does it take carpets to dry after steam cleaning?”
- With our truck-mounted power? Usually 4-6 hours, sometimes less! We achieve this through extremely hot water (which evaporates faster) and industrial-strength suction. Rental units or less powerful vans can leave carpets damp for 24-48 hours, which is risky. We get you back on your floors fast.
-
“Is steam cleaning safe for pets and kids?”
- Yes! In fact, it’s one of the safest methods. We use eco-certified, non-toxic cleaning solutions. The high heat naturally sanitizes, reducing allergens and bacteria. Pets and kids can usually return to the area once the carpet is dry (which, as we said, is quick with us!).
